Web17 Jan 2024 · Injury types (A, B, or C) The injury subtypes are hierarchical descriptors that progress from stable to unstable. These injuries result in a severe instability that cannot be controlled by anterior or posterior surgery … minimal typographic free wordpress themeWeb1 May 2015 · The PLC serves as a posterior "tension band" of the spinal column and plays an important role in the stability of the spine . A torn PLC has a tendency not to heal and can lead to progressive kyphosis and collapse.
